Abstract

The invention discloses an intelligent campus management system based on the Internet of things, which comprises a server, wherein the server is internally provided with: the teacher management module is used for realizing the arrangement of a class schedule and the management of teacher attendance, training and teaching tasks; the student management module is used for realizing the management of student attendance, learning tasks and physical and mental health; the school production management module is used for realizing the management of the school production through the inspection robot and the electronic tag configured on each school production; the system is also used for realizing the management of production correction and maintenance records; and the campus security management module is used for realizing comprehensive monitoring of the campus through the access control module, the camera and the sensor group which are arranged in the campus so as to ensure the safety of the campus. According to the invention, the efficient roll call operation of the student on class is realized through the design of the positioning module and the fingerprint input module, and the roll call condition can be well avoided; parents can clearly know the learning condition, the physical and mental health state and the current position of the child in the school.

Technical Field
The invention relates to the field of intelligent management systems, in particular to an intelligent campus management system based on the Internet of things.
Background
The campus is a necessary place for all teaching activities, and the existing teaching activities are only suitable for realizing corresponding teaching management in a manual mode, (1) teachers in each class obtain class rate through class roll calling, and meanwhile, roll calling for the representative is common; (2) parents cannot timely know the recent learning condition of students; (3) the parents cannot know whether the students play at the campus, or in the bedroom, or out of the campus, or go home or go to school every day; (4) how the physical and mental health condition of the students is, etc. which the parents cannot master. (5) The production correction management needs manual counting operation at regular time, and the maintenance and use records are disordered. (6) The campus security is mostly realized by human monitoring, and security holes easily appear.

In this embodiment, the campus security management module includes:
The access control module is used for realizing the identification and authentication of the identities of people entering and leaving the campus, the library and other areas; preferably, face recognition is carried out;
The camera is used for recording video images of all areas in the campus in real time;
The sensor group is used for realizing the acquisition of environmental data in the teaching building; such as smoke sensors, toxic gas sensors, temperature and humidity sensors, etc.;
And the safety evaluation module is used for realizing automatic evaluation of the personnel identity information, the video image data of each area and the environmental data in the teaching building which are identified by the access control module, outputting a corresponding evaluation result, and starting the alarm module when the evaluation result falls into a preset threshold. Specifically, the person identity information abnormality is evaluated through the repetition rate of the person identity information, and when a certain identity has entering identity identification information but does not have exiting identity identification information, the identity identification information appears repeatedly, and the person identity information is judged to be abnormal; when video image data is evaluated, a video frame taking script is called first, an image is obtained at intervals of a certain number of frames, then a generated target detection model is used for detecting each image, whether the image is abnormal or not is judged, if the image is abnormal, a position frame and an abnormal type are marked on the abnormal part, and positioning information (namely positioning information of a camera) in an image Exif (exchangeable image file format) is read. The target detection model adopts an ssd target detection algorithm, an initiation v2 deep neural network is pre-trained by a coco data set, then the model is trained by a previously prepared data set, various parameters in the deep neural network are finely adjusted, and finally a suitable target detection model for detecting video abnormity (such as a fire source, a carried sharps and the like) is obtained;

In this embodiment, still include the head of a family terminal (adopt APP) that realizes the communication with the server (support cell phone terminal, the computer terminal logs in), head of a family registers the back of logging in, can realize looking over of student's study life condition through visiting the server, can inquire student terminal place locating information as required simultaneously, when needing inquiry locating information, head of a family terminal sends the control command who starts student terminal's fingerprint entry module through the server, student terminal receives control command and starts fingerprint entry module, guide the student to accomplish recording of fingerprint, the fingerprint matching back, student terminal carried locating module starts to carry out reading of student terminal place geographical position information this moment, and send the reading result to head of a family terminal through the server.
